Fireworks and drugs have been seized in Brownlow, Banbridge last night following reports of disturbances in the area.
Police say a small group of young people were cautioned and one was taken to hospital.
They'd issued several warnings about misuse in the run-up to Halloween.
The group face penalties for numerous offences.
